I have a nice DSL line at my home but, can only get a dial-up at the office. Right now the e-smith server in the office handles web/mail/etc but, what I want to do is:
- have mail/web go to the server in the home and
- relay that mail to the server in the office
In other words:
MAIL --> e-smith server abc.com --> another e-smith server.abc.com
How do I configure the e-smith server at my home to forward ALL email sent to it on to the remote office...or set that one up to pull it down from the home machine?

> or set that one up to pull it down from the home machine?
You can always pull the mail directly off the home server per user/client using IMAP or POP, provided that the IMAP/POP access is set to Public.
